Scottsville in Allen County, Kentucky — The American South (East South Central)
 

Mt. Union Church / M.J. Bonner

 
 
Mt. Union Church / M.J. Bonner Marker (Side 1) image. Click for full size.
Photographed By Tom Bosse, July 5, 2019
1. Mt. Union Church / M.J. Bonner Marker (Side 1)
Inscription.
Mt. Union Church
Organized in 1864 under the name of Mulberry Hill General Baptist Church. In 1869 the original log building burned. The congregation rebuilt on present site, changed the name to Mt. Union. Thirteen churches were invited from Mt. Union to form Portland Association in 1921, making Mt. Union the mother church of two associations.

M.J. Bonner
Burial site about 65 feet east of here; born on Dec. 17, 1825 and died Nov. 21, 1907. Rev. Bonner organized the Mt. Union General Baptist Church which stands on these grounds. He is known as the founder of 3 associations: the Mt. Union, Green River Union, New Harmony Assoc. of Gen. Baptists.

Marker presented by Bonner Memorial Fund.
 
Erected 1968 by Kentucky Historical Society and Kentucky Department of Highways. (Marker Number 1117.)
